Output 881c4786ae93f6a42aea5b6235ca187e9e606cdf6cee84895ebfa9bafbaf656a:1

value
789108
script pubkey
OP_0 OP_PUSHBYTES_20 d004b1b66be70628677fa44c421fff1774d154e5
address
ltc1q6qztrdntuurzseml53xyy8llza6dz48937x6s0
transaction
881c4786ae93f6a42aea5b6235ca187e9e606cdf6cee84895ebfa9bafbaf656a
spent
true